BSc (Hons) Criminology and Criminal Justice at Swansea University Fees
The fee breakup of the Swansea University BSc (Hons) Criminology and Criminal Justice includes the first-year tuition fee and cost of living. The cost of living will include expenses like rent for accommodation, meals, and other utilities. The total average Swansea University cost of living can be around GBP 5,000. The first-year tuition fees BSc (Hons) Criminology and Criminal Justice is GBP 14,150. Students must note that the total expenses are subject to vary, depending on the additional charges set by the Swansea University. BSc (Hons) Criminology and Criminal Justice at Swansea University Highlights
- The criminology undergraduate degree will give students the opportunity to examine the many factors involved in criminal behaviour, and how society responds through the criminal justice system
- Students will study the most important theories of crime and deviance and their relevance to contemporary criminal justice policy, research, and practice
- Students will also gain an in-depth knowledge of the structures of the criminal justice system, covering the courts, prison, the probation service, and the police
- It is a flexible degree structure with a range of optional modules in second and third years gives students plenty of scope to tailor their studies to their particular interests, career goals, or ambitions for postgraduate study
